State of the Market results revealed

March 21, 2023
The first annual State of the Market survey looks at view towards innovation, systems vs. components, and procurement trends across the photonics community.

Laser Focus World gave a peek into the results of the first annual State of the Market research results. The survey was fielded to the brand’s broad horizontal audience, with the goal of gaining valuable insights from a mix of executives and engineers into photonics and optics purchase expectations for 2023, preferences when looking at systems rather than components, and what value buyers place on innovations. The respondents were a global in nature, although 73% were based in North America.

There were some clear takeaways from the research. Specifically, even though economic uncertainty is impacting every market, a healthy percentage of buyers (roughly 80%) anticipate buying more photonics- and optics-related goods throughout 2023. Only 14% expect their purchases to remain the same as in 2022. In dealing with economic uncertainty, 37% said they are willing to expand their list of suppliers while 30% are more focused on buying components domestically.

Another interesting takeaway: from a buyer’s perspective, there seems to be uncertainty around a market-driven strategy to move towards offering systems or subassemblies rather than componentry. While 50% of manufacturers are likely to shift towards systems or subassemblies, the largest percentage of buyers either does not seem to have a preference (36%) or sees a shift as unlikely (36%).

However, buyers do heavily favor working with manufacturers who themselves place an emphasis on innovation, with 54% saying innovation is either important or extremely important. The noticeable desire for offerings with better capabilities than previous iterations is not a surprise in a still relatively young industry.

In addition, we asked how buyers are dealing with the many supply chain concerns that crippled companies throughout the pandemic. Improving resiliency through better sourcing (51%), embracing what-if scenarios (41%), and seeking more strategic partnerships (34%) surfaced as the most meaningful strategies.
